Dr Georg Eder rose from humble origins to hold a number of high positions at Vienna University and the city's Habsburg court between 1552 and 1584. This book examines his position as a Catholic in the predominantly Protestant Vienna of his day and his survival as an advocate of Catholic reform, largely through the protection of Habsburgs' rivals.
